Number: 82810895
Country: Sweden
Source: TED
Number: 78545741
Number: 513726
Country: Spain
Number: 513727
Country: Denmark
Number: 513728
Country: Germany
Number: 513729
Country: Slovenia
Number: 513730
Country: Finland
Number: 513731